HHSAA Division I volleyball: Kai Enriques fashions fifth-place finish for Ka’u

Hawaii Tribune-Herald

It was only fitting that Kai Enriques got to bow out on a big stage: Honolulu’s Blaisdell Arena.

Enriques helped carry the Ka’u volleyball program to new heights, and he applied the finishing touches to his career with 18 kills Saturday as the Trojans beat Hawaii Prep 25-22, 25-19 in the HHSAA Division II fifth-place match.

On Enriques’ watch, the Trojans (14-4) have one BIIF title – their first – and one runner-up finish to go along with fourth- and fifth-place finishes at states.

Brian Gascon added seven kills and Damon Hertz posted four for Ka’u (14-4), which avenged two earlier losses to Ka Makani (10-8), including a four-game setback in the BIIF title match.
